#7eb550 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7eb550 is composed of 49.4% red, 71%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.8%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 92.7 degrees, a saturation of 40.6% and a lightness of 51.2%. #7eb550 color hex could be obtained by blending #fcffa0 with #006b00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

Shades and Tints of #7eb550
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030402 is the darkest color, while #f8fbf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7eb550
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#828580 is the less saturated color, while #78f80d is the most saturated one.
